    Community Field Officer

    Job Description:
    Social, Sustainability, & Environment.

    Social license to operate: Planning Stage

    • Identify the different stakeholders in the project's area of influence;
    • Carry out the additional socio-economic diagnosis of the area;
    • Raise relevant information to the area from secondary sources;
    • Implement the social income action management plan;

    Social license to operate: Procurement Stage

    • Coordinate and conduct informational meetings with communities in the area of influence, social leaders, and local associations.
    • Actively participate in monitoring and approaching identified stakeholders.
    • Register and respond to complaints and claims received from different stakeholders and ensure that they are resolved as per the grievance mechanism.
    • Mediate possible low to median disputes between the Anglo team and the community.
    • Attend meetings with stakeholders, when required

    Social license to operate: Maintenance Stage

    • Coordinate and conduct informational meetings with communities in the area of influence, social leaders, and local associations.
    • Execute the activities committed in the Social Strategy and/or programs of the social investment plan.
    • Document and monitor the interactions and commitments established with the different stakeholders.
    • Register, and respond to complaints and claims received from different stakeholders.
    • Monitor the work zones to avoid any social incident that becomes a risk for the operations (i.e. accompaniment to the technical team in the field).

    General Tasks

    • To carry out a permanent follow-up to the Community alerts received;
    • Support the gathering of information in the field for the elaboration of the different baselines, according to Angola regulations (e.g. social, environmental, flora and fauna, archaeology);
    • Participate in the elaboration and analysis of socio-environmental diagnostic reports.
    • Participate in the preparation of social investment plans;
    • Identify social risks (both for the project and for the communities) and participate in the design of mitigation measures.
    • Participate in the preparation and delivery of communication plans with key stakeholders;
